If you setup the remote access VPN on the ASA to use SSL-VPN (tcp/443 and udp/443) then you could port forward those ports to the ASA and leave udp/500 on the router for IPSec VPN's. HTH

B. Change the port of SSL VPN. ASA(config)# http server enable ASA(config)# http outside ASA(config)# webvpn ASA(config-webvpn)# port 444 ASA(config-webvpn)# enable outside. For the above scenario, ASDM listens on default port 443 while SSL VPN uses port 444.

